    La Bog

    This often jam-packed Irish pub is in Northbridge's backpacker heartland. It may be a package Irish franchise (there's one in Fremantle as well) but it's still a reasonable and popular place to sit and sip on a Guinness amongst friends. Live bands offer a fun night of dancing and the 06:00 close means you can grab an early-morn nightcap.

    Brass Monkey

    This massive pub, built in 1897, boasts several different areas and vibes. Take your pick: sit up on a stool at the bar, lean back in the relaxed beer garden or hunker down on a sofa by the fire. The food’s good, too.

    Brisbane

    It was a very clever architect indeed who converted this classic corner pub (1898) into a thoroughly modern venue, where each space seamlessly blends into the next. Best of all is the large courtyard where the palms and ponds provide a balmy holiday feel.
